> I have installed the linux-image-2.6.30 on my Lenny system to be able
> to use the ext4 filesystem. I converted my ext3 /home partition
> without problems, and it works perfectly, faster.
>
> Would it be safe to also convert my ext3 root partition (no /boot
> here) to ext4 if I upgrade my grub installation to the one provided by
> the backports?
I am doing this on one laptop and it works perfectly. I guess you need
to add rootfstype=ext4 to the kernel command-line to make it boot
correctly.
